"""
|
||||
Create a class that can be passed into `attrs.field`'s ``eq``, ``order``,
|
||||
and ``cmp`` arguments to customize field comparison.
|
||||
|
||||
The resulting class will have a full set of ordering methods if at least
|
||||
one of ``{lt, le, gt, ge}`` and ``eq`` are provided.
|
||||
|
||||
Args:
|
||||
eq (typing.Callable | None):
|
||||
Callable used to evaluate equality of two objects.
|
||||
|
||||
lt (typing.Callable | None):
|
||||
Callable used to evaluate whether one object is less than another
|
||||
object.
|
||||
|
||||
le (typing.Callable | None):
|
||||
Callable used to evaluate whether one object is less than or equal
|
||||
to another object.
|
||||
|
||||
gt (typing.Callable | None):
|
||||
Callable used to evaluate whether one object is greater than
|
||||
another object.
|
||||
|
||||
ge (typing.Callable | None):
|
||||
Callable used to evaluate whether one object is greater than or
|
||||
equal to another object.
|
||||
|
||||
require_same_type (bool):
|
||||
When `True`, equality and ordering methods will return
|
||||
`NotImplemented` if objects are not of the same type.
|
||||
|
||||
class_name (str | None): Name of class. Defaults to "Comparable".
|
||||
|
||||
See `comparison` for more details.
|
||||
|
||||
.. versionadded:: 21.1.0
|
||||
"""
